    Vision: a web service for face recognition using convolutional network

    This paper proposes a face recognition module built as a web service. We introduce a novel design and mechanism for face recognition on a web platform and to memorize most recent users for the user. This web service is called Vision and developed using the Flask and TensorFlow deep learning framework. The face recognition process is powered by FaceNet deep convolutional network model. The face recognition process done by Vision could also be utilized for user authentication and user memorization, both done in on a web platform. As a demonstration of concept and viability, in this study, Vision is integrated into a web-based voice chatbot. The testing and evaluation of Vision’s face recognition process show an overall F-score of one for all test scenarios

    Particle swarm optimization for solving thesis defense timetabling problem

    The thesis defense timetabling problem is a fascinating and original NP-hard optimization problem. The problem involves assigning the participants to defense sessions, composing the relevant committees, satisfying the constraints, and optimizing the objectives. This study defines the problem formulation that applies to Universitas Multimedia Nusantara (UMN) and use the particle swarm optimization (PSO) algorithm to solve it. As a demonstration of concept and viability, the proposed method is implemented in a web-based platform using Python and Flask. The implementation is tested and evaluated using real-world instances. The results show that the fastest timetable generation is 0.18 seconds, and the slowest is 21.88 minutes for 25 students and 18 department members, without any violation of the hard constraints. The overall score of the EUCS evaluation for the application is 4.3 out of 6

    Cleveree: an artificially intelligent web service for Jacob voice chatbot

    Jacob is a voice chatbot that use Wit.ai to get the context of the question and give an answer based on that context. However, Jacob has no variation in answer and could not recognize the context well if it has not been learned previously by the Wit.ai. Thus, this paper proposes two features of artificial intelligence (AI) built as a web service: the paraphrase of answers using the Stacked Residual LSTM model and the question summarization using Cosine Similarity with pre-trained Word2Vec and TextRank algorithm. These two features are novel designs that are tailored to Jacob, this AI module is called Cleveree. The evaluation of Cleveree is carried out using the technology acceptance model (TAM) method and interview with Jacob admins. The results show that 79.17% of respondents strongly agree that both features are useful and 72.57% of respondents strongly agree that both features are easy to use

    Rule-based lip-syncing algorithm for virtual character in voice chatbot

    Virtual characters changed the way we interact with computers. The underlying key for a believable virtual character is accurate synchronization between the visual (lip movements) and the audio (speech) in real-time. This work develops a 3D model for the virtual character and implements the rule-based lip-syncing algorithm for the virtual character's lip movements. We use the Jacob voice chatbot as the platform for the design and implementation of the virtual character. Thus, audio-driven articulation and manual mapping methods are considered suitable for real-time applications such as Jacob. We evaluate the proposed virtual character using hedonic motivation system adoption model (HMSAM) with 70 users. The HMSAM results for the behavioral intention to use is 91.74%, and the immersion is 72.95%. The average score for all aspects of the HMSAM is 85.50%. The rule-based lip-syncing algorithm accurately synchronizes the lip movements with the Jacob voice chatbot's speech in real-time

    Go-Ethereum for electronic voting system using clique as proof-of-authority

    Current advances in information technology have brought about significant changes, including ways to carry out elections using computer technology known as e-voting. Blockchain underlies the popularity of the digital currency Bitcoin and some other digital money, sparking the start of a new era of Internet use, including electronic voting (e-voting) system. In this work, we proposed designing and implementing an evoting system powered by the Ethereum blockchain. We used real-world data from the Indonesian Election Commission (KPU) with 26 candidates and 15,725 voters from the Jelupang sub-district. The testing and evaluation results using three miners in the blockchain show that the system could commit around 23 transactions per second. All 15,725 votes are committed to the blockchain successfully within 12.75 minutes. The total time required for creating all blockchain accounts is 13.4 hours.

    In corporate governance literatures, board diversity is often assumed to increase board efficacy and monitoring, thus increase market performance. In this study board is defined as the combination of board of commissioners and directors since Indonesia uses two-tier board system. The purpose of this research is to investigate the effect of board diversity as measured by board member‟s nationality on firm‟s market performance as measured by price to book value ratio. This research also used company size and industry type as control variables. Samples consisted of 52 companies in 2006, 69 companies in 2007, and 45 companies in 2008, totalling 166 observation. All sample companies were listed at Indonesia Stock Exchange from the year 2006 until 2008. The hypothesis test using multiple regression analysis showed that board member‟s nationality does not have any significant impact on firm‟s market performance. On the other hand, size and industry type do have significant effects on firm‟s market performance
